The Response to lawsuit letter sample is a legal document used by defendants to formally respond to a plaintiff's complaint in a court case. It allows the defendant to present their answers to the allegations made against them and to assert any affirmative defenses. Key features of this form include a clear structure that outlines the defendant's defenses and the specific admissions or denials of each allegation in the complaint. Users should fill in personal information, including names and addresses, make sure to address each paragraph of the complaint, and include a certificate of service verifying that the plaintiff received a copy of the response. Your response should cover every paragraph in the complaint and whether you admit or deny each point raised. If you can't remember whether part of the complaint is correct, it may be safer to deny it and avoid relying on your memory. For each point that you admit or deny, include a brief reason why.

In law, an answer refers to a defendant's first formal written statement to a plaintiff's initial petition or complaint. This opening written statement will admit or deny the allegations, or demand more information about the claims of wrongdoing.

Affirmative defense?Examples On [Date], after making the contract and the alleged breach, and before this action was commenced, defendant paid to the plaintiff the sum of [specify amount], which was accepted by the plaintiff in full satisfaction and discharge of the damages claimed in the petition.
